K-Flex AL Clad
Elastomeric Insulation Clad with Aluminum Foil/Laminated to Polypropylene Sheet
Nomaco K-Flex AL Clad, available in both tubular and sheet form is a composite product comprised of flexible closed cell elastomeric insulation adhered to an outer covering comprised of an abuse resistant, easy to clean, aesthetic polypropylene sheet laminated to an aluminum foil, providing salt resistance, UV protection and impact resistance. It is an ideal choice for food processing plants, pharmaceutical, film processing, electronics and other clean room applications. The polypropylene / aluminum cladding provides a secondary moisture vapor barrier inherent to the closed cell foam core. The primary function of the cladding is abuse resistance, clean ability and protection from UV rays. The smooth shiny surface is tough, impact resistant and dust free, resistant to acids, alkali, salts, oil, fats, aliphatic hydrocarbons and is highly impermeable to gases and moisture. The flexible cladding provides resistance to traffic (does not dent like traditional metal jackets) as well as excellent appearance and easy maintenance. The K-Flex AL Clad system allows for quick and easy replacement should this be required. The unique closure system (over lap system for longitudinal seams and butt joints) no through seams insures against moisture penetration. No special tools and fewer materials necessary at the job site make proper installation a snap. K-Flex AL Clad is light and easy to handle. The K-Flex AL Clad system provides installed cost savings over traditional metal jacket systems with improved performance in many cases. Nomaco K-Flex AL Clad is available in sheet or roll form with an easy to use aggressive self seal PSA system. This composite product has a low thermal conductivity and a high water vapor diffusion resistance factor. It practically eliminates the problem of under insulation corrosion. It is easy to install and combines constant performance with low maintenance requirements. The performed elbows and matching tape make install quick, professional, with excellent appearance and durability. Standard K-Flex AL Clad can be used within a wide range of temperatures from -297F to +220F K-Flex ECO should be requested as the foam core on stainless steel applications above 100F. The temperature range is for K-Flex ECO is from -297F to +300F. Nomaco K-Flex AL Clad is a fiber free, non-porous insulation product. K-Flex AL Clad is CFC and HCFC free, with an Ozone Depletion Potential of Zero. These characteristics make it easy to comply with Health, Safety and Environmental requirements. Tubular product is available in all standard IDs 1/2and 1 wall thicknesses in nominal 3 foot lengths. Sheet product is available in 36x48 dimensions or 48 wide rolls up to 2 thick. The sheets and rolls are available with an aggressive acrylic pressure sensitive adhesive (PSA) with fiber glass scrim reinforcement and a moisture/tear resistant polyolefin easy release liner.

K-FLEX LS TUBE

Flexible closed cell elastomeric pipe insulation Designed for the professional contractor

Made in America

Tube Unslit
DESCRIPTION
K-FLEX LS Pipe Insulation is an environmentally friendly, CFC-free, flexible elastomeric thermal insulation. It is black in color, marked in gold ink, identified as K-FLEX LS, and is available in unslit tubular form in wall thicknesses of 3/8",1/2", 3/4", 1" or 1-1/2 in sizes ranging from 3/8" I.D. to 8" IPS. KFLEX LS key physical properties are approved through supervision by Factory Mutual Research Corporation. K-FLEX LS Tube is non-porous, non-fibrous and resists mold growth.

UNDERGROUND
For buried lines above the water table, use a clean fill such as sand (3"-5" layer) to protect K-FLEX LS before backfilling. It is recommended that materials to be buried are properly sealed at all seams and butt joints with an approved contact adhesive. For optimum performance, the lines should be encased in a conduit to protect them from problems associated with ground water.

APPLICATIONS
K-FLEX LS is used to retard heat gain and prevent condensation or frost formation on refrigerant lines, cold water plumbing, and chilled water systems. It also retards heat loss for hot water plumbing, liquid heating, dual temperature piping, and many solar systems. K-FLEX LS is designed for the professional contractor. K-FLEX LS is recommended for applications ranging from -297F to 220F (-182C to 104C). The expanded closed cell structure makes K-FLEX LS an efficient insulator and an effective moisture vapor retarder. K-FLEX LS has a very tough skin which withstands tearing, rough handling, and severe environmental conditions, and yet is quite flexible for easy installation. K-FLEX LS has superior cold weather flexibility. K-FLEX LS Tube can be used with heat tracing/heat tapes.

RESISTANCE TO MOISTURE VAPOR FLOW


The closed-cell structure and unique formulation of K-FLEX LS effectively retards the flow of moisture vapor, and is considered a low transmittance vapor retarder. For most applications, K-FLEX LS needs no additional protection. Additional vapor barrier protection may be necessary for KFLEX LS when installed on low temperature surfaces that are exposed to continuous high humidity.

INSTALLATION
With a factory-applied coating of talc on the smooth inner surface, K-FLEX LS slides easily over pipe or tubing for quick installation. When applied to existing lines, tubing is slit lengthwise and snapped into place. (Slitting can be done on the job with a sharp knife or pre-slit K-FLEX LS is available on request.) All seams and butt joints should be sealed with an approved contact adhesive, making sure both surfaces to be joined are coated with adhesive. Fittings are fabricated from miter-cut tubular sections and cover, flanges, etc., from K-FLEX LS SHEET.

OUTDOOR APPLICATIONS
K-FLEX LS Pipe Insulation is made from a UV resistant elastomeric blend. For moderate UV exposure applications, no additional protection is needed. However, for severe UV exposure applications (rooftop applications) or where optimum performance is required, 374 UV Protective Coating or appropriate jacketing or cladding should be used. For best appearance, two coats are recommended. For more detailed information refer to the Application Guide.

K-FLEX LS SHEET

S2S Sheet
DESCRIPTION
K-FLEX LS SHEET Insulation is an environmentally friendly, CFC-free, flexible elastomeric thermal insulation. It is black in color, marked in gold ink, and supplied as flat sheets (36" x 48") in standard thicknesses of 1/8" through 2". It is supplied skin two sides in 1/4 and above. K-FLEX LS SHEET is also available in rolls, with a standard roll width of 48". K-FLEX LS SHEET key physical properties are approved through supervision by Factory Mutual Research Corporation. This product is non-porous, fiber free and resistant to mold and mildew.

RESISTANCE TO MOISTURE VAPOR FLOW


The expanded closed-cell structure and unique formulation makes K-FLEX LS SHEET an efficient insulator and provides effective moisture vapor resistance. For most indoor applications, K-FLEX LS SHEET needs no additional protection. Additional vapor barrier protection may be necessary for K-FLEX LS SHEET when installed on low temperature surfaces that are exposed to continuous high humidity.

APPLICATIONS
K-FLEX LS SHEET Insulation is used to retard heat gain and prevent condensation or frost formation on cold equipment, ducts, or large O.D. pipes. It also effectively retards heat loss when used on hot equipment, ducts, or large pipes. K-FLEX LS SHEET can be used as a duct covering. K-FLEX LS SHEET is recommended for applications ranging from -297F to 220F (-182C to 104C) when used as pipe insulation where only the seams and butt joints are glued. When full adhesion application is used, the upper limit is 200F (93C). K-FLEX LS SHEET has a very tough skin which withstands tearing, rough handling, and severe environmental conditions, and yet is quite flexible for easy installation. K-FLEX LS SHEET has superior cold weather flexibility. K-FLEX LS SHEET thickness has been calculated to control condensation on cold surfaces. Refer to the table on the reverse side for specific recommendations.

FLAME AND SMOKE RATING


K-FLEX LS SHEET Insulation in thicknesses of 1 1/2" (38 mm) and below has a flame spread rating of 25 or less and a smoke development rating of 50 or less as tested by ASTM E 84 Method of Testing entitled: Surface Burning Characteristics of Building Materials. K-FLEX LS SHEET is acceptable for use in plenum applications meeting the requirements of NFPA 90A.

INSTALLATION
When K-FLEX LS SHEET Insulation is applied to ductwork and equipment, use 100% coverage of an approved contact adhesive. Since it is a contact adhesive, both surfaces to be joined should be coated and then joined after the adhesive is dry to the touch. Compression joints with adhesive applied should be used on all butt edges. K-FLEX LS SHEET is also available with pre-applied pressure sensitive adhesive (PSA) with easy to use release liner. Refer to specific installation instructions.

K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L
flexible closed cell elastomeric pipe insulation Designed for the professional contractor
DescriPtion
K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L Pipe Insulation is an environmentally friendly, CFC-free, flexible elastomeric insulation, pre-slit with a factory-applied pressure sensitive adhesive. It is black in color and identified as K-FLEX LS. This superior closed cell insulation is designed to retard heat flow and prevent condensation when properly installed. K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L Pipe Insulation is pre-slit with a factory applied specially formulated long-lasting bonding adhesive applied to both seam surfaces and comes with convenient built-in release liners which allow for easy installation. It is available in wall thicknesses of 3/8" through 1" and in sizes ranging from 3/8" to 4" IPS. K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L key physical properties are approved through supervision by Factory Mutual Research Corporation. It is non-porous, non-fiberous and resistant to mold growth.

feAtures & benefits


K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L offers the advantage of easier handling handling & installation. Faster install Ideal for straight runs Less use of contact adhesives

resistAnce to Moisture VAPor flow


The closed-cell structure and unique formulation of K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L effectively retards the flow of moisture vapor, and is considered a low transmittance vapor retarder. For most indoor applications, K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L needs no additional protection. Additional vapor barrier protection may be necessary for K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L when installed on low temperature surfaces that are exposed to continuous high humidity.

APPlicAtions
K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L has the same excellent insulation properties as standard K-FLEX LS and is used on similar applications such as refrigerant lines, cold water plumbing, roof drains and chilled water systems. K-FLEX LS SELFSEAL is recommended for applications ranging from -40F to 200F (-40C to 93C) for both new and existing applications. For best results, store and install K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L at temperatures above 40F (4C). K-FLEX LS SELF-SEALs closure system is designed to save labor costs. It greatly reduces the use of contact adhesives, thus allowing for improved working conditions and compliance with OSHA requirements. K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L has superior cold weather flexibility. K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L can be used with heat tracing/heat tapes.

flAMe AnD sMoke rAting


K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L Self-Seal Pipe Insulation in wall thicknesses up to 1-1/2" (38 mm) has a flame spread rating of 25 or less and a smoke development rating of 50 or less as tested by ASTM E 84 Method of Testing entitled: Surface Burning Characteristics of Building Materials. K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L is acceptable for use in duct/plenum applications meeting the requirements of NFPA 90A.

instAllAtion
K-FLEX LS SELF-SEAL is pre-slit with factory applied adhesive (PSA) to both seam surfaces and convenient built-in tabs for easy installation: slip on the tube, pull the tab, pinch it shut and apply pressure to the seams. The seam should be positioned to be on the bottom of the pipe.
